Okay wow! Sometimes trying something new is incredibly exciting. Last night was tandoori chicken burgers and although it sounds mediocre, it was amazing!!!! The recipe is simple, marinate boneless, skinless chicken thighs in some spices, through it in the food processor to grind it up, make small patties and grille them. Serve with pita, cilantro and cucumber. I added sweet walla walla onions in a bit of vinegar with a tsp (approx) of sugar (Double double's creation) and a yogurt sauce of 1/2 c fat free plain yogurt with 1 tsp cumin and sea salt and ground pepper. It was a great meal! The chicken had lots of flavor but was not spicy hot. I had the leftovers today for lunch as a salad and it was just as good. In addition to being yummy, this dinner was also very economical. Chicken thighs are cheaper than breasts but still good. I'm no fan of dark meat but chicken thighs are technically light meat and not fatty at all. And when you grind them yourself you get a much leaner product and not mystery "chunks". You could make a batch of these up and then freeze the patties for a quick meal too. I think you could even get away with subbing in some tofu or soy textured protein to extend this and make it even cheaper. And because the tandoori is so flavorful I think you could even make this with straight tofu and just add some egg white or something to hold the patties together.
